.elementor-48 .elementor-element.elementor-element-5e6a28a{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:2px;--padding-bottom:2px;--padding-left:2px;--padding-right:2px;}.elementor-48 .elementor-element.elementor-element-5e6a28a: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-5e6a28a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-354a7a0 );}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-48 .elementor-element.elementor-element-26812c1{padding:30px 0px 0px 0px;}.elementor-48 .elementor-element.elementor-element-26812c1 .elementor-heading-title{font-family:"Playfair", Sans-serif;font-size:52px;font-weight:600;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-48 .elementor-element.elementor-element-1381de1{padding:0px 0px 30px 0px;color:var( --e-global-color-primary );}.elementor-48 .elementor-element.elementor-element-92feef4{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:50px;--padding-bottom:50px;--padding-left:0px;--padding-right:0px;}.elementor-48 .elementor-element.elementor-element-cd71336 .elementor-heading-title{font-family:"Playfair", Sans-serif;font-size:52px;font-weight:600;}.elementor-48 .elementor-element.elementor-element-e5e6f2f{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;}.elementor-48 .elementor-element.elementor-element-83119a9{--display:flex;--border-radius:10px 10px 10px 10px;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-48 .elementor-element.elementor-element-83119a9: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-83119a9 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-354a7a0 );}.elementor-widget-icon-box.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-primary );}.elementor-widget-icon-box.elementor-view-framed .elementor-icon, .elementor-widget-icon-box.elementor-view-default .elementor-icon{fill:var( --e-global-color-primary );color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-widget-icon-box .elementor-icon-box-title, .elementor-widget-icon-box .elementor-icon-box-title a{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-size:var( --e-global-typography-primary-font-size );font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-icon-box .elementor-icon-box-title{color:var( --e-global-color-primary );}.elementor-widget-icon-box:has(:hover) .elementor-icon-box-title,
					 .elementor-widget-icon-box:has(:focus) .elementor-icon-box-title{color:var( --e-global-color-primary );}.elementor-widget-icon-box .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-48 .elementor-element.elementor-element-41393dc .elementor-icon-box-wrapper{align-items:start;gap:15px;}.elementor-48 .elementor-element.elementor-element-8b3368e{--display:flex;--border-radius:10px 10px 10px 10px;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-48 .elementor-element.elementor-element-8b3368e: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-8b3368e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-354a7a0 );}.elementor-48 .elementor-element.elementor-element-6eb7db6 .elementor-icon-box-wrapper{align-items:start;gap:15px;}.elementor-48 .elementor-element.elementor-element-ee4c9dc{--display:flex;--border-radius:10px 10px 10px 10px;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-48 .elementor-element.elementor-element-ee4c9dc: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-ee4c9dc >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-354a7a0 );}.elementor-48 .elementor-element.elementor-element-3bec65f .elementor-icon-box-wrapper{align-items:start;gap:15px;}.elementor-48 .elementor-element.elementor-element-a66096a{--display:flex;--border-radius:10px 10px 10px 10px;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-48 .elementor-element.elementor-element-a66096a: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-a66096a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-354a7a0 );}.elementor-48 .elementor-element.elementor-element-c19cae0 .elementor-icon-box-wrapper{align-items:start;gap:15px;}.elementor-48 .elementor-element.elementor-element-6f14850{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-48 .elementor-element.elementor-element-6f14850: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-6f14850 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F5F6F7;}.elementor-48 .elementor-element.elementor-element-01913a9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-48 .elementor-element.elementor-element-efa0ec8 .elementor-heading-title{font-family:"Playfair", Sans-serif;font-size:22px;font-weight:600;color:#B71C1C;}.elementor-48 .elementor-element.elementor-element-7bd8e77 .elementor-heading-title{font-family:"Playfair", Sans-serif;font-size:36px;font-weight:600;}.elementor-48 .elementor-element.elementor-element-264e562{font-family:"Lato", Sans-serif;font-weight:400;color:#4A4A4A;}.elementor-widget-divider{--divider-color:var( --e-global-color-secondary );}.elementor-widget-divider .elementor-divider__text{color:var( --e-global-color-secondary );font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-divider.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on{color:var( --e-global-color-secondary );border-color:var( --e-global-color-secondary );}.elementor-widget-divider.elementor-view-framed .elementor-icon, .elementor-widget-divider.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-secondary );}.elementor-48 .elementor-element.elementor-element-5865721{--divider-border-style:dotted;--divider-color:#000;--divider-border-width:1px;}.elementor-48 .elementor-element.elementor-element-5865721 .elementor-divider-separator{width:100%;}.elementor-48 .elementor-element.elementor-element-5865721 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-48 .elementor-element.elementor-element-38c7bec{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-48 .elementor-element.elementor-element-6f69b1f{--display:flex;}.elementor-48 .elementor-element.elementor-element-c11d70a{font-family:"Lato", Sans-serif;font-weight:400;color:var( --e-global-color-primary );}.elementor-48 .elementor-element.elementor-element-e75e8ad{--display:flex;}.elementor-48 .elementor-element.elementor-element-83c8445{color:var( --e-global-color-primary );}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-48 .elementor-element.elementor-element-6a4632e .elementor-button{background-color:var( --e-global-color-b10a958 );fill:#FFFFFF;color:#FFFFFF;border-radius:5px 5px 5px 5px;}.elementor-48 .elementor-element.elementor-element-bbef7ad{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:50px;--padding-bottom:50px;--padding-left:0px;--padding-right:0px;}.elementor-48 .elementor-element.elementor-element-bbef7ad:not(.elementor-motion-effects-element-type-background), .elementor-48 .elementor-element.elementor-element-bbef7ad >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-primary );}.elementor-48 .elementor-element.elementor-element-6bffa0b .elementor-heading-title{font-family:"Playfair", Sans-serif;font-size:52px;font-weight:600;color:#F6F7F9;}.elementor-48 .elementor-element.elementor-element-e930915{color:#F6F7F9;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-48 .elementor-element.elementor-element-01913a9{--width:50%;}.elementor-48 .elementor-element.elementor-element-38c7bec{--width:50%;}}@media(max-width:1024px){.elementor-48 .elementor-element.elementor-element-5e6a28a{--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-48 .elementor-element.elementor-element-cd71336{padding:20px 20px 20px 20px;}.elementor-48 .elementor-element.elementor-element-e5e6f2f{--grid-auto-flow:row;}.elementor-widget-icon-box .elementor-icon-box-title, .elementor-widget-icon-box .elementor-icon-box-title a{font-size:var( --e-global-typography-primary-font-size );}.elementor-48 .elementor-element.elementor-element-6bffa0b{padding:20px 20px 20px 20px;}}@media(max-width:767px){.elementor-48 .elementor-element.elementor-element-5e6a28a{--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}.elementor-widget-heading .elementor-heading-title{font-size:var( --e-global-typography-primary-font-size );}.elementor-48 .elementor-element.elementor-element-cd71336{padding:20px 20px 20px 20px;}.elementor-48 .elementor-element.elementor-element-cd71336.elementor-element{--align-self:center;}.elementor-48 .elementor-element.elementor-element-e5e6f2f{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-widget-icon-box .elementor-icon-box-title, .elementor-widget-icon-box .elementor-icon-box-title a{font-size:var( --e-global-typography-primary-font-size );}.elementor-48 .elementor-element.elementor-element-6bffa0b{padding:20px 20px 20px 20px;}.elementor-48 .elementor-element.elementor-element-6bffa0b.elementor-element{--align-self:center;}}/* Start custom CSS for container, class: .elementor-element-6f14850 *//* Fees Section */
.mp-fees-section{
  background:#F5F6F7;
  padding:90px 20px;
}

.mp-fees-wrap{
  max-width:1140px;
  margin:0 auto;
}

.mp-fees-eyebrow{
  color:#B71C1C;
  font-size:14px;
  font-weight:700;
  letter-spacing:.08em;
  text-transform:uppercase;
  margin-bottom:12px;
}

.mp-fees-heading{
  color:#1F2E4A;
  margin-bottom:18px;
}

.mp-fees-text{
  color:#4A4A4A;
  font-size:17px;
  line-height:1.7;
  max-width:520px;
}

.mp-fee-stack{
  display:flex;
  flex-direction:column;
  gap:20px;
}

.mp-fee-card{
  background:#fff;
  border:1px solid rgba(31,46,74,.10);
  border-radius:16px;
  box-shadow:0 10px 30px rgba(0,0,0,.06);
  padding:28px;
}

.mp-fee-title{
  color:#1F2E4A;
  font-size:22px;
  font-weight:600;
  margin-bottom:10px;
}

.mp-fee-price{
  color:#1F2E4A;
  font-size:42px;
  font-weight:700;
  line-height:1.1;
  margin-bottom:6px;
}

.mp-fee-detail{
  color:#6F6F6F;
  font-size:16px;
  line-height:1.5;
}

.mp-fee-button .elementor-button{
  background:#B71C1C !important;
  border-radius:10px !important;
  padding:14px 24px !important;
  font-weight:700 !important;
}

@media (max-width: 767px){
  .mp-fees-section{
    padding:70px 20px;
  }

  .mp-fee-price{
    font-size:34px;
  }
}/* End custom CSS */
/* Start custom CSS for html, class: .elementor-element-045cc0d */:root{
  --navy:#1F2E4A;
  --red:#B71C1C;
  --gray:#6F6F6F;
  --light:#F5F6F7;
  --line:#E3E7EC;
}
*{box-sizing:border-box}
body{
  margin:0;
  font-family:Inter,Arial,sans-serif;
 /* background:#f6f7f9;*/
  color:#1d2430;
}
/*.mp-insurance{
  padding:80px 20px;
}*/
.mp-wrap{
  max-width:1200px;
  margin:0 auto;
  background:#fff;
  border:1px solid var(--line);
  border-radius:24px;
  box-shadow:0 12px 30px rgba(0,0,0,.05);
  padding:48px;
}
.eyebrow{
  margin:0 0 8px;
  color:var(--red);
  font-weight:700;
  letter-spacing:.08em;
  text-transform:uppercase;
  font-size:14px;
}
h2{
  margin:0 0 12px;
  color:var(--navy);
  font-family:"Playfair Display",Georgia,serif;
  font-size:42px;
  line-height:1.1;
}
.intro{
  margin:0 0 28px;
  max-width:740px;
  color:#475467;
  font-size:18px;
  line-height:1.6;
}
.logo-grid{
  display:grid;
  grid-template-columns:repeat(4,minmax(0,1fr));
  gap:20px;
}
.logo-card{
  min-height:112px;
  border:1px solid var(--line);
  border-radius:18px;
  background:#fbfcfd;
  display:flex;
  align-items:center;
  justify-content:center;
  padding:20px;
  text-decoration:none;
  transition:.2s ease;
}
.logo-card img{
  max-width:180px;
  max-height:44px;
  filter:grayscale(100%);
  opacity:.75;
  transition:.2s ease;
}
.logo-card span{
  color:#6f6f6f;
  font-weight:700;
  text-align:center;
  line-height:1.3;
}
.logo-card:hover{
  transform:translateY(-2px);
  box-shadow:0 10px 20px rgba(0,0,0,.06);
  border-color:#cfd6df;
}
.logo-card:hover img{
  filter:none;
  opacity:1;
}
.logo-card:hover span{
  color:var(--navy);
}
.notes{
  margin-top:22px;
  font-size:14px;
  color:#667085;
}
@media (max-width: 1024px){
  .logo-grid{grid-template-columns:repeat(3,minmax(0,1fr));}
}
@media (max-width: 767px){
  .mp-wrap{padding:28px 20px;}
  h2{font-size:34px;}
  .logo-grid{grid-template-columns:repeat(2,minmax(0,1fr));}
}/* End custom CSS */